Default Life of your Z

Originally posted by SLVR Z
I'm seriously considering clear bra now... I got tons of rock chips and other crap on my front bumper. How long do these clear bras last till it start fading? (That's assuming they fade.)
Daniel, the fella that did my Z, said that it lasts the lifetime of your Z. He also said to wax it along with the rest of your car like the bra isn't there kinda thing. He also told me that the more chips you have before install of bra the longer it takes for the water that is stuck in those chips to evaporate. When he squeegies the water out the chipped areas create a bubble affect until the water is evaporated. He just told me to leave the Z in the sun so the heat will wipe out the water bubbles. On mine, I only have 2 areas that have a bubble(chip area) in it so its not too bad.
